Overview
Obtain laboratory samples from patients as required. Perform laboratory procedures and analyze results according to established policies. Prepare solutions, reagents, standards, and controls in accordance with SOPs. Respond to requests and inquiries for test results by methods required by SOPs. Communicate test results to appropriate parties in accordance with established SOPs. Perform routine instrument maintenance including setup, calibration, and maintenance. Identify and report equipment malfunctions in accordance with DAP practices. Assist in evaluation of technical procedures and provide input into development/maintenance of policies and procedures for assigned work area. Participate in departmental training and orientation by demonstrating established laboratory procedures to new employees and students. Assist with information management such as workload statistics (gathering information, completing analysis, recording information). Maintain inventory of supplies (identify depleting stock, notify personnel, complete requisitions and forward for approval and ordering). Perform other related duties as assigned
